1963 BMW 1800 | 1957 Renault Colorale | |
Make | BMW | Renault |
Model | 1800 | Colorale |
Year Released | 1963 | 1957 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1766 cc | 1996 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 90 HP | 51 HP |
Engine RPM | 5250 RPM | 3200 RPM |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1100 kg | 1585 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4510 mm | 4280 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1710 mm | 1990 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1760 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2560 mm | 2670 mm |
